binfire 发表于 2020-8-26 15:08:59

python如何较简单的将一个较长的整数拆分成单个整数

最近刚开始学python,想要解决一个小问题,
比如我想要把一个身份证号中的生日读取出来,应该怎么办呢?不用调用其他库可以实现吗?
如果要把每个数列出怎么实现?
谢谢各位大佬帮助!!!

昨非 发表于 2020-8-26 15:23:50

list1=str(input("请输入身份证号:"))

#提取生日
birthday=list1
print("The birthday is:",birthday)

#逐个打印
for i in list1:
    print(i)

昨非 发表于 2020-8-26 15:29:09

或者加上年月日,本质为列表的切片操作

list1=str(input("请输入身份证号:"))

#提取生日
#birthday=list1
print("The birthday is:",list1,"年",list1,"月",list1,"日")

#逐个打印
for i in list1:
    print(i)

binfire 发表于 2020-8-26 15:38:17

昨非 发表于 2020-8-26 15:23


谢谢,原来就这么简单,这些在最开始几课里面都有学习,看来还是对数据的类型理解有问题,谢谢您{:5_106:}

昨非 发表于 2020-8-26 15:38:51

binfire 发表于 2020-8-26 15:38
谢谢,原来就这么简单,这些在最开始几课里面都有学习,看来还是对数据的类型理解有问题,谢谢您{:5_106: ...

不客气,刚入门都一样,记得给个最佳哦{:10_297:}
页: [1]
查看完整版本: python如何较简单的将一个较长的整数拆分成单个整数